Output 6decdbaad03afc48441894c58891bf85b8439142fc7752c6cf9c57caa7d01746:5

value
24543366
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a3dc4652a425cd135a279383543c6309385c21f OP_EQUALVERIFY OP_CHECKSIG
address
1C9MS4ZeCVHHjxTjbX7mBwf9mSZs3szUE8
transaction
6decdbaad03afc48441894c58891bf85b8439142fc7752c6cf9c57caa7d01746
confirmations
536148
spent
true